What is Milton Friedman’s view of corporate social responsibility?

Overview. Friedman introduced the theory in a 1970 essay for The New York Times titled “A Friedman Doctrine: The Social Responsibility of Business is to Increase Its Profits”. In it, he argued that a company has no social responsibility to the public or society; its only responsibility is to its shareholders.

What is the concept of Corporate Social Responsibility CSR?

What is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R)? The concept of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) is generally understood to mean that corporations have a degree of responsibility not only for the economic consequences of their activities, but also for the social and environmental implications.

Is CSR Classics a drag racing game?

This wiki is devoted to information about the game CSR Classics, which features drag racing and has only antique cars. CSR Classics is a game developed by BossAlien Studios, with the help of Mad Atom Studios. NaturalMotion released the game, as a classic counterpart to its more modern “cousin”, CSR Racing.

What kind of cars are in CSR classic?

Being called CSR Classics, the game does not feature any modern cars. Instead, the game uses more vintage cars, like the Lancia Stratos, Aston Martin DB5, the Pontiac GTO, Chevrolet Corvette Stingray (C3), and the Ford GT40. You can buy each car in a “Loved” or “Unloved” state.
